uniapp小程序支持vue3 setup写法。以下是对这一结论的详细解释和佐证: 1. 官方文档确认 uniapp作为一款使用Vue.js开发所有前端应用的框架,它支持Vue的多个版本,包括Vue3。在Vue3中,setup是组合式API的一个重要部分,它允许开发者以一种更灵活和模块化的方式来组织组件逻辑。因此,如果uniapp支持Vue3,那么它也应该...
二、页面中使用下拉刷新功能和加载更多效果 import { onPullDownRefresh , onReachBottom } from "@dcloudio/uni-app"onPullDownRefresh(() => {console.log("下拉刷新")})onReachBottom(() => {console.log("上拉加载更多")}) 三、启动下拉刷新,进行关闭。 uni.stopPullDownRefresh(); 感谢大家观看,我...
3. 修改需要单独配置分享的页面 // pages/news/news.vue 在页面你想要修改的地方修改uni.$mpShare的值就可实现差异化, 上面代码在页面onLoad时会将其设置为初始的统一页面的值,并且在页面onUnload时也会被设置为初始的统一页面 推荐阅读
使用vue2方式 不使用setup语法糖,这样会在app.vue中存在两个script,这种方式导致在app.vue中的setup语法糖获取globalData比较吃力 export default { onLaunch(options) { console.log('App Launch', options) }, globalData: { text: 'text' } }const instance = getCurrentInstance() onLaunch((options) => { ...
uniapp vue3 setup开发笔记 uniapp vue3 setup写法中使用onload,onshow等生命周期 首先通过这种方式引入 import { onShow, onHide,onLoad }from"@dcloudio/uni-app"和vue3普通生命周期一样的使用 onShow(()=>{ }) onLoad(()=>{ }) ... pages.json中的easycom...
【uniapp】CSS样式穿透(vue3 setup 微信小程序) 如果想要在编译为微信小程序时使用样式穿透,光使用 `::v-deep` 没效果,查了文档发现需要设置 `options: { styleIsolation: "shared" }`, 但是此时我用的setup语法很离谱,查阅不到相关内容,尝试多次最后的解决方法如图所示,增加一个script标签设置即可。
1、建立 share.js 代码如下,用于统一设置分享参数: import{ onShareAppMessage,onShareTimeline }from'@dcloudio/uni-app';constonShare =()=>{ onShareAppMessage(()=>{return{title:'123',path:'/pages/loading/loading'} }) onShareTimeline(()=>{return{title:'456',path:'/pages/loading/loading'}...
setup 是 vue3 的语法糖,使用 setup 可以自动导出定义的变量和方法。 模板<template> template 里面包含该组件的 html 结构,可以在该组件内使用其他组件,如果使用 setup 语法糖,导入的组件无需注册可以直接使用,如果不使用 setup 语法糖,就需要在 components 内注册组件。
使用最新跨端技术 uniapp+vue3+uv-ui+pinia2实战微信app聊天UniappVue3Chat。整个项目采用Hbuilderx4.0.8创建,使用 vue3 setup语法糖编码开发。使用技术编辑器:HbuilderX 4.0.8技术框架:Uniapp+Vue3+Pinia2+Vit…
uniapp 使用Vue3 setup组合式API 引入 uniapp 的 页面生命周期 <template> <view class="content"> <image class="logo" @click="han